Stella Mae Emery Old Town – Stella Mae Emery, 74, died on February 15, 2011 surrounded by her loving family. Stella was born on Sept. 15, 1936 in Stillwater the daughter of Quinton and Phyllis (Storeman) Darling. Stella graduated from Old Town High School in 1954. She held a variety of jobs including seamstress, caregiver, and a receptionist at a Doctor’s office, but her primary position had always been as a homemaker. Stella enjoyed quilting, crocheting, and playing cribbage. She was an excellent cook, and a wonderful mother, grandmother, and friend. Stella recently left her many dear friends at the Marsh Island Apartments in Old Town to move in with her daughter Sonya. Sonya was able to provide loving and compassionate care for her mother while she was in her home.
